Now if you wouldn't mind I have a simple question...I hope. I have an '06 H2 that I am trying to strip all the chrome off of. Most everything is straight forward, using this site for help, but I've come to the rear vents over the tail lights. From what I've googled, it seems they are probably double sided tape on? But does anyone know the proper way to remove these? I would like to keep them intact so they can be painted black. Oh also, I believe these are the cheap plastic ones, not the aluminum one. If there the stick on ABS chrome covers like you said, then just carefully peal back till they let loose and the original vents should be under them. No need now to paint black I would think. Hope this helps, I actually had some ABS covers on a few items that I just carefully pulled on till they let go to reveal the stock black ABS
